The purpose of scoping is to help identify issues to be considered in the Environmental Impact Assessment and the degree of detail necessary to assess the impacts.
The Scoping Consultation was initially undertaken in May/June 2011 whereby scoping reports were submitted to Northamptonshire County Council, prior to undertaking community engagement and a full Environmental Impact Assessment, as follows:

Due to some misunderstandings of the purpose of the consultation by a few of the respondents the County repeated the exercise in August 2011.
The results of the consultation are taken into account in the Environmental Statement.
